Our team specializes in trauma-informed psychotherapy based on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Narrative Therapy, DBT, Art Therapy, and Sand Tray work.  These are all options for bad weather days or days where clients would like to explore and process without horses.
​Equine-Assisted Psychotherapy uses the strength, presence, and kindness of the horses through the EAGALA model to teach you how to start loving life again. Working directly with horses reveals new levels of understanding about ourselves without any judgment. Together with the herd of 6, we create goals which are heart-based and authentic. 

Our model provides a framework with infinite possibilities for adaptability and creativity specific to the situation and individual.  

Our mission is to support and guide you in your journey to better health and happiness. You will make a profound change for yourself, your partner, family, or your team when you start achieving your goals of healing, advancement, success, and excellence!

At "Unbridled", we specialize in working with individuals ages 4-85, couples, families, and group therapy. Pia has advanced clinical experience working with a wide range of topics, including profound dissociation, DID, and BPD.

We also provide learning and leadership opportunities for groups of all ages, as well as supervision for unlicensed candidates and consultation to licensed mental health clinicians.
